Jiang (4) China

Ji-li Jiang ( )

Before coming to America, Ji-li Jiang endured the Cultural Revolution in China which was brought to life in the pages of her autobiography Red Scarf Girl. Since its publication, she has been asked to speak at hundreds of venues and conferences ~ all in an attempt to promote cultural understanding. She wrote this on her web page: “…a better understanding among people around the world is the only route to global peace.” After leaving China where she was a science teacher, Ji-li Jiang studied in Hawaii & worked for a hotel chain there, she worked for a healthcare company in Chicago, and also lived in the Seattle area. She ultimately settled in the San Francisco Bay area. Her parents live near her and they visit daily. Her father still appears in films under the name Henry O.

Ji-li Jiang ( ) Her writing has garnered over 15 different awards. With her writing, one goal is to do her part to achieve global peace. In 2003, she started a nonprofit organization called Cultural Exchange International which promotes both cultural and business exchanges between China and the west. She continues her speaking engagements at schools and various conferences throughout the world. She has even led large groups of people to China so others can understand its rich culture.
